2. SysML diagrams

SysML is based on UML (and can therefore be considered by users as a "UML profile"). SysML reuses, with possible adaptation, seven UML diagrams (activities, sequence, states, use cases, block definition, internal block, package) and proposes two new ones (requirements and parametric).
